Systemax over the weekend re-launched the Circuit City web site, retaining much of the non-defunct retailer's look and feel and offering a full range of consumer electronics products.
The move came after the company -- which also owns the new CompUSA as well as TigerDirect.com -- bought up the Circuit City brand, trademark, web site and other assets in mid-May. The deal also included all of Circuit City's old customer records.
As part of the kickoff, Systemax is offering $1.99, same-day shipping on products purchased from the "new" site and has promised to expand the e-retailer's product selection in the next few months. Perhaps most importantly, the company has also pledged to improve the CircuitCity.com customer service experience with 24/7 availability, addressing one problem area (i.e. customer service) that many credited with the downfall of the original Circuit City.
